A final sentence of conviction after the pronouncement of the Supreme Court and the doors of prison have opened for a businessman from Campania.
The man, well known in the Caserta area, will have to serve one year and ten months in prison for an episode that occurred in Porto Cervo in 2012. The Carabinieri executed the arrest warrant issued by the Court of Appeal of Sassari.
According to the investigations and the documents of the trial held in Tempio , on the night between 3 and 4 October 2012 the defendant entered the room of a housekeeper in his villa in Pantogia and tried to abuse the woman.
The victim reacted and managed to push him away, but the man kicked and punched her. Having escaped from the villa, after wandering around Porto Cervo, the woman was rescued and taken to the hospital by the staff of the Costa Smeralda Consortium Surveillance Institute.
She was subsequently followed and supported by volunteers from the Prospettiva Donna association in Olbia. In court, the victim was represented by the lawyer Ivano Iai.
